{#- Python HTTP test function template for pytest/urllib
Context variables:
- fn_name: sanitized test function name
- description: fixture description with period appended
- method: HTTP method (uppercase)
- path: fixture path
- headers_py: Python dict literal for headers
- has_body: bool
- body_py: Python literal for JSON body
- expected_status: HTTP status code
- has_text_body: bool
- text_py: Python literal for expected text body
- has_json_body: bool
- json_py: Python literal for expected JSON body
- has_partial_body: bool
- partial_body_checks: array of {key, py_val} dicts
- header_assertions: array of {name, assertion_type, value} dicts
- has_validation_errors: bool
- validation_errors: array of {loc_py, escaped_msg} dicts
#}
def test_{{ fn_name }}(mock_server: str) -> None:
"""{{ description }}"""
import os # noqa: PLC0415
import urllib.request # noqa: PLC0415
base = os.environ.get("MOCK_SERVER_URL", mock_server)
url = f"{base}{{ path }}"
_headers = {{ headers_py }}
{%- if has_body %}
import json # noqa: PLC0415
_headers.setdefault("Content-Type", "application/json")
_body = json.dumps({{ body_py }}).encode()
_req = urllib.request.Request(url, data=_body, headers=_headers, method="{{ method }}")
{%- else %}
_req = urllib.request.Request(url, headers=_headers, method="{{ method }}")
{%- endif %}
class _NoRedirect(urllib.request.HTTPRedirectHandler): # noqa: N801
def redirect_request(self, *args, **kwargs): return None # noqa: E704
_opener = urllib.request.build_opener(_NoRedirect())
try:
response = _opener.open(_req) # noqa: S310
status_code = response.status
resp_body = response.read() # noqa: F841
resp_headers = dict(response.headers) # noqa: F841
except urllib.error.HTTPError as _exc:
status_code = _exc.code
resp_body = _exc.read() # noqa: F841
resp_headers = dict(_exc.headers) # noqa: F841
assert status_code == {{ expected_status }} # noqa: S101
{%- if has_text_body %}
assert resp_body.decode() == {{ text_py }} # noqa: S101
{%- elif has_json_body %}
import json as _json # noqa: PLC0415
data = _json.loads(resp_body)
assert data == {{ json_py }} # noqa: S101
{%- elif has_partial_body %}
import json as _json # noqa: PLC0415
data = _json.loads(resp_body)
{%- for check in partial_body_checks %}
assert data["{{ check.key }}"] == {{ check.py_val }} # noqa: S101
{%- endfor %}
{%- endif %}
{%- for assertion in header_assertions %}
{%- if assertion.assertion_type == "present" %}
assert "{{ assertion.name }}" in resp_headers # noqa: S101
{%- elif assertion.assertion_type == "absent" %}
assert resp_headers.get("{{ assertion.name }}") is None # noqa: S101
{%- elif assertion.assertion_type == "uuid" %}
import re # noqa: PLC0415
assert re.match(r'^[0-9a-f]{8}-[0-9a-f]{4}-[0-9a-f]{4}-[0-9a-f]{4}-[0-9a-f]{12}$', resp_headers["{{ assertion.name }}"]) # noqa: S101
{%- else %}
assert resp_headers["{{ assertion.name }}"] == "{{ assertion.value }}" # noqa: S101
{%- endif %}
{%- endfor %}
{%- if has_validation_errors %}
import json as _json # noqa: PLC0415
_data = _json.loads(resp_body)
errors = _data.get("errors", [])
{%- for ve in validation_errors %}
assert any(e["loc"] == [{{ ve.loc_py }}] and "{{ ve.escaped_msg }}" in e["msg"] for e in errors) # noqa: S101
{%- endfor %}
{%- endif %}
